Bandits: Four People Kidnapped, Shops Robbed in Bauchi Village Attack

Bandits
A group of armed bandits attacked Gyale Village in the Mansur District of Alkaleri Local Government Area, Bauchi State, on Sunday, July 20, 2025, abducting four residents and looting several local shops.
The assailants reportedly gained access to the village through the Yankari Game Reserve before launching the assault, during which five shops were broken into and robbed.
Spokesperson for the Bauchi State Police Command, SP Ahmed Wakil, confirmed the incident, identifying the kidnapped individuals as 32-year-old Tasiu Malam Yahaya, 15-year-old Hakilu Ubayo, 28-year-old Abdul Aziz Suleiman, and 16-year-old Rabiu Ganjua—all believed to be shop owners taken from their business premises.
Following the attack, security forces, including local vigilantes and a special unit of hunters, were swiftly deployed to the scene under the directive of the Bauchi State Commissioner of Police, Sani Omolori-Aliyu.
“The Commissioner immediately tasked the Divisional Police Officer in Alkaleri, along with other security outfits in the area, to initiate a coordinated patrol and launch a manhunt for the kidnappers,” Wakil said.
He added that the area is now stable, with residents resuming their daily activities, although law enforcement agents continue to search the surrounding forests in a bid to locate the victims and apprehend the criminals.
“The command remains committed to rescuing those abducted and bringing the perpetrators to justice. Our personnel are actively combing the area and following all leads,” Wakil assured.
The police have urged the public to remain vigilant and report any suspicious activity, as efforts to ensure the safety of residents and restore peace continue.
